Both Bryce and Zion are beautiful. Watchman is a good place to camp because it is next to the Zion visitors center where the buses start, and end, their trips. You can't drive north into the canyon anymore, rather ride buses which make frequent stops. You can get off and explore as often as you want, then catch the next bus since one stops at each pull-off every few minutes. You can't take your camper on highway 9 through Zion due to restrictions in the long tunnel near the east side of the park, so plan to enter and exit from, and to, the west. Cedar City is a nice community on I-15, between the 2 parks. HAAPy trails!
Been to both several times. Best make reservations. Never had an issue getting through the tunnel. If you pull in the park with a trailer or rv over X size they will charge you the ten dollars for the tunnel escort. During the summer they usually just have one way trafffic at a time through the tunnel. Last one through carries the baton to the other side and passes it off. Bryce will be cooler and a nice respite from the heat. As mentioned going up canyon in Zion requires the use of the shuttle system. It may sound like a pain but it actually works pretty good. During peak times they come every few minutes and start as early as 5:30 and I think they go until midnight. Before the shuttle you literally had to wait for parking at each stop.
Both parks have campgrounds outside the parks that are close as well. Both places take and drink plenty of water.

We did that trip 2 years ago and it was great.We stayed at Panguich(sp?)lake.Nice campground and nice people. A little rustic with all hookups except TV and the fishing wasn't bad either.I think it was about an hour to both Zion and Bryce.The road in was a little challenging but not too bad.

We went in the off season ( spring of '07 ) The shuttles run during the summer so we were able to drive. Fewer people and the weather was great. Zion is beautiful any time, and the shuttle is nice for the crowds.
